1. Does a robot really operate on you, or is the surgeon still in control?
This is the single biggest misconception about robotic surgery, and the answer is simple: the robot does not operate on its own. It cannot make decisions, initiate movement, or perform any surgical action independently.
What actually happens is that your surgeon sits at a console a few feet from the operating table and controls every movement of the robotic arms in real time. The system translates the surgeon’s hand movements into smaller, more precise motions within your body, filters out any natural hand tremor, and provides the surgeon with a magnified 3D view of the surgical site. Think of it less as “a robot doing surgery” and more as an advanced extension of the surgeon’s own hands and eyes.
2. How is robotic surgery different from laparoscopic and open surgery?
All three approaches aim to treat the same conditions, but they differ in technique:
- Open surgery uses a single large incision to give the surgeon direct access and a full field of view.
- Laparoscopic surgery uses a few small incisions, a camera, and long, rigid instruments that the surgeon operates by hand.
- Robotic surgery also uses small incisions, but the instruments are wristed — meaning they bend and rotate in ways the human hand and standard laparoscopic tools can’t — combined with a high-definition 3D camera and tremor-free precision.
In short, robotic surgery builds on the benefits of laparoscopy (small incisions, less trauma) while adding a level of dexterity and visualisation that’s hard to achieve with either open or standard laparoscopic techniques, particularly in tight or hard-to-reach spaces like the pelvis.
3. Is robotic surgery actually safe? What are the real risks?
Robotic surgery carries the same general risks as any surgical procedure — infection, bleeding, and reactions to anaesthesia. These risks aren’t unique to the robotic approach; they exist with open and laparoscopic surgery too.
There is one risk that is specific to robotic procedures: equipment or system malfunction. However, this is rare, occurring in a very small fraction of cases, and operating rooms are equipped to convert to a different technique immediately if needed.
Overall, robotic surgery is considered at least as safe as traditional approaches, and for many procedures, studies show fewer complications, less blood loss, and lower infection rates. That said, robotic surgery isn’t the right choice for every patient or every condition — your surgeon will evaluate your specific case before recommending it.
4. How much pain will I have after surgery, and how long is recovery?
Because robotic surgery uses small incisions instead of one large cut, patients typically report significantly less post-operative pain than after open surgery, and many need less pain medication during recovery.
Recovery time depends heavily on the specific procedure, but general patterns include:
- Hospital stay: Many patients go home the same day or within 24–48 hours, compared to several days for open surgery.
- Return to light activity: Often within a week or two.
- Full recovery: Anywhere from 2 to 6 weeks, depending on the complexity of the procedure.
Your surgical team will give you a recovery timeline specific to your procedure — don’t rely on general estimates alone when planning time off work or travel.
5. How long does robotic surgery actually take?
This varies widely by procedure. Simple operations like a robotic gallbladder removal may take around 1–2 hours, while more complex procedures — such as prostatectomies, hernia repairs with mesh placement, or cardiac valve repairs — can take 3 hours or more.
It’s worth noting that robotic setup (positioning the patient and docking the robotic arms) adds some time compared to open surgery, but this is often offset by shorter hospital stays and faster healing afterwards. If procedure length is a concern for you, ask your surgeon for a time estimate specific to your case and any factors that might extend it.
6. Which surgeries and health conditions commonly use robotic assistance?
Robotic surgery is now used across a wide range of specialities, including:
- Urology: Prostate, kidney, and bladder cancer surgery; correction of urinary tract obstructions
- Gynaecology: Fibroid removal, hysterectomy, treatment of endometriosis and uterine prolapse
- General surgery: Gallbladder removal, hernia repair (including complex hiatal hernias), colon resection, bariatric surgery
- Cardiac surgery: Mitral valve repair, coronary artery procedures
- Head and neck / ENT: Transoral robotic surgery for throat and tongue base tumours
- Orthopaedics and spine: Robotic-assisted knee replacement and spinal fusion
Not every condition qualifies for a robotic approach — your surgeon will consider your diagnosis, anatomy, and overall health before recommending it.
7. Is robotic surgery more expensive, and is it covered by insurance?
Robotic surgery generally comes with a higher upfront cost than traditional or laparoscopic surgery, largely due to the cost of the equipment and specialised surgical teams. However, many patients find this partially offset by shorter hospital stays, fewer follow-up complications, and a faster return to work.
As for insurance, most major insurers cover robotic surgery when it’s used for a medically necessary procedure, the same way they’d cover the open or laparoscopic version. Coverage details — including co-pays, deductibles, and whether a specific hospital or surgeon is in-network — vary by insurer and plan. Before your procedure, it’s worth calling your insurance provider directly and asking:
- Is robotic-assisted surgery covered under my plan for this specific procedure?
- Will I pay a different amount than for the non-robotic version?
- Are my surgeon and hospital in-network?
8. What is the success rate of robotic surgery compared to traditional methods?
For most well-established procedures — such as prostatectomies, hysterectomies, and gallbladder removal — robotic surgery has success and complication rates that are comparable to, and in some studies better than, open and laparoscopic techniques. Benefits like reduced blood loss, lower infection rates, and faster recovery are well documented across multiple specialities.
That said, “success” depends heavily on the individual case, the complexity of the condition being treated, and — importantly — the experience of the surgeon performing the procedure. A highly experienced robotic surgeon performing a routine case will generally have better outcomes than a less experienced one, regardless of the technology used. This is why a surgeon’s experience matters as much as the technique itself.
9. Am I a good candidate for robotic surgery?
Robotic surgery isn’t automatically the right choice for everyone. Your care team will typically consider:
- The type and stage of your condition
- Your overall health and medical history
- Previous surgeries in the same area (scar tissue can complicate robotic access)
- Your age and ability to tolerate anaesthesia (age alone is rarely a disqualifying factor if you’re medically stable)
- Whether a robotic platform is even available for your specific procedure

10. How do I find a qualified, experienced robotic surgeon?
Since robotic surgery requires specialised training beyond standard surgical education, not every surgeon — even within the same speciality — performs robotic procedures. When choosing a surgeon, consider asking:
- How many robotic procedures of this specific type have you performed?
- What additional certification or training do you have in robotic surgery?
- What are your complication and conversion-to-open-surgery rates?
- Which robotic system does the hospital use, and how long has it had it?
- What happens if the robotic approach needs to be converted to open surgery mid-procedure?
Choosing a high-volume, experienced surgeon at a hospital with an established robotic surgery program is one of the strongest predictors of a good outcome.
